Transaction 431c20c9b668a34411a4af42291306653424ac870ef668b39b696342449886e5

1 Input
2 Outputs
  • 431c20c9b668a34411a4af42291306653424ac870ef668b39b696342449886e5:0
  • value  773945156
    address  37FVtzJEoYEHpzsif4YidTpF8co54yLg8B
  • 431c20c9b668a34411a4af42291306653424ac870ef668b39b696342449886e5:1
  • value  5955776
    address  3BcKoYLtcb6HNSjCVNifFQNPbPrwBPsX4L